Abstract:
This 3D point cloud model is an assemblage of student design proposals developed in the design studio Making Greenways led by Guest Prof. Philipp Urech and Univ.-Prof Susann Ahn at TU Wien. Focused on the Wien River, the studio explored blue-green infrastructure strategies for enhancing urban livability, climate resilience, and ecological diversity. Using site-specific digital modelling techniques, students envisioned linear park typologies inspired by international greenway precedents, particularly from Seoul. The assembled point cloud model, geolocated in EPSG 31256 and edited from the 2023 Aerial Laser Scan of the City of Vienna (data.wien.gv.at), regroups these proposals into a single model that visualizes alternative futures for the river corridor within Vienna’s urban landscape.
